Publisher's Synopsis
This publication explains the stages and symptoms of dementia, how it affects the brain, and how it affects the person and their families. It is a comprehensive guide to understanding and living with dementia - what to expect, what services may be required, how to cope with day-to-day challenges, etc. It describes current treatments and ongoing medical research, and includes first hand experience from people diagnosed with dementia, their families, and their carers, providing insight into what it's like living with these types of disorder.
